About The Position

The Shop Supervisor at Ziegler Cat is responsible for overseeing a team of Technicians, focusing on their hiring, development, and daily coaching. This role involves managing service call labor in D365, ensuring repairs are completed safely and efficiently, and maintaining high standards of quality and safety within the shop environment.

Responsibilities

  • Assign work to technicians for service calls
  • Approve employee time in Workday or D365
  • Monitor service calls to ensure estimates are met
  • Manage bay space and verify additional work request details
  • Collaborate on invoice disputes and service call details
  • Troubleshoot parts availability issues
  • Work with technicians to ensure standard jobs are met
  • Complete incident reports and conduct branch safety walks
  • Ensure appropriate PPE is used and uphold safety standards
  • Review completed Job Safety Analyses (JSAs)
  • Work with employees to create a safety accountability plan
  • Hold regular safety meetings and uphold contamination control standards
  • Review technicians' work for quality and timeliness
  • Validate technicians' documentation on parts warranty
  • Resolve customer complaints in partnership with service advisors
  • Facilitate tool replacement and torque testing program
  • Provide input on parts inventory at the branch
  • Stay updated on new equipment/products and technical topics
  • Answer technician questions and coach on service calls
  • Conduct performance action conversations and hold team meetings
  • Monitor and enforce employee training completion
  • Plan training for technicians based on customer needs
  • Build team morale through routine conversations and team activities
  • Interview and hire technicians
  • Support the technician intern mentor program
  • Oversee onboarding of new technicians
  • Complete annual employee performance reviews
  • Maintain employee records in Workday
  • Support employee career development and answer benefits questions
  • Work with HR for employee accommodations and leave situations
  • Coordinate with Workers Compensation for restricted work accommodations
